I have a 700x38c will this tire fit
If your current tire is 700x38 you can run most any 700c tire that is wider than the width of your rim. If your rim is 25mm wide, you could run a 700x28 tire. If you want to go wider you can even use a 700x40 tire if your frame has the clearance for a 40mm tire.

I have a specialized 700x42 Will the kenda 700 x 40 Work on this rim
In almost every case, a rim that can accept a 700x42 tire can accept a 700x40 tire. As long as the rim is less than 40mm wide you can run a 700x40 tire.

Are the 700x28 ok for gravel/dirt bike paths?
This is totally fine for dirt and gravel paths! It can be a matter of personal preference as well, but I don't have any issues taking my 700x28 tires on a hard packed gravel road. When riding on gravel or dirt, I would suggest riding at a lower PSI since this will provide more grip. Of course, keep it within the PSI range as indicated on the side of the tire.
